Conversion between charge and spin: chiral organic solids versus inorganic crystals
摘要
Both inorganic and organic chiral materials have been exploited to achieve conversion between charge and spin—chirality-induced spin selectivity (CISS) and inverse CISS (ICISS). Inorganic and organic solids represent two distinct platforms of CISS/ICISS, in which chirality modifies the extended Bloch states in the former but locally alters carrier hopping among molecular states via a Berry phase in the latter, suggesting that CISS/ICISS is fundamental in chiral materials.
